WebJun 14, 2024 · You can also check for diastasis recti in the comfort of your own home. Here’s how to do it: Get comfortable on a flat surface like a firm bed or yoga mat. Lie on your back with your knees bent and your feet on the surface below. Place two fingers in the space directly above your belly button. Gently exhale and then lift your head. WebAug 24, 2024 · Diastasis recti. Diastasis recti happens when the connective tissue between your rectus abdominis (six-pack) muscles is stretched, creating an abnormally wide distance between the muscles. A vertical bulge down the midline of the abdomen can be seen in many newborns when intra-abdominal pressure increases. In this photo, a shadow lateral to the bulge can be seen going up the left side of the abdomen, starting near the umbilical clamp.
